Transaction 70bb777297e7d32bdee6c6601a3a879de19732ffc0458bb762436aeb42e109aa
1 Input
1 Output
-
70bb777297e7d32bdee6c6601a3a879de19732ffc0458bb762436aeb42e109aa: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bf8c285db3505920d5613e46c8600bdac86e7d1abca38b76bfe491f60944c382
- address
- bc1ph7xzshdn2pvjp4tp8ervscqtmtyxulg6hj3cka4lujglvz2ycwpqff0f83